Output 881afcaf1b856aae1be53a9c204b901ac65ef4584be69244ac03cb31ec497803:5

value
136028
script pubkey
OP_0 OP_PUSHBYTES_20 52538dc48aa072ea6504594d21d68ddda60052f3
address
bc1q2ffcm3y25pew5egyt9xjr45dmknqq5hneqjcts
transaction
881afcaf1b856aae1be53a9c204b901ac65ef4584be69244ac03cb31ec497803
spent
true